This repository provides a comprehensive review of how people in Sub saharan Africa rate their Health and Health Care. # Introduction The study examines how Sub-Saharan Africans perceive their health and healthcare systems, revealing that the region has the lowest global ratings for well-being and satisfaction with health services. Despite heavy donor investment, especially in HIV/AIDS programs, many residents report poor health and dissatisfaction with care quality. The research aims to understand regional variations and the factors influencing these perceptions, including age, education, income, religion, and HIV prevalence.
